target-arm: initial coprocessor register framework
Initial infrastructure for data-driven registration of coprocessor register implementations. We still fall back to the old-style switch statements pending complete conversion of all existing registers. Signed-off-by: Peter Maydell <peter.maydell@linaro.org>

+static void cp_reg_reset(gpointer key, gpointer value, gpointer opaque)
+{
+ /* Reset a single ARMCPRegInfo register */
+ ARMCPRegInfo *ri = value;
+ ARMCPU *cpu = opaque;
+
+ if (ri->type & ARM_CP_SPECIAL) {
+ return;
+ }
+
+ if (ri->resetfn) {
+ ri->resetfn(&cpu->env, ri);
+ return;
+ }
+
+ /* A zero offset is never possible as it would be regs[0]
+ * so we use it to indicate that reset is being handled elsewhere.
+ * This is basically only used for fields in non-core coprocessors
+ * (like the pxa2xx ones).
+ */
+ if (!ri->fieldoffset) {
+ return;
+ }
+
+ if (ri->type & ARM_CP_64BIT) {
+ CPREG_FIELD64(&cpu->env, ri) = ri->resetvalue;
+ } else {
+ CPREG_FIELD32(&cpu->env, ri) = ri->resetvalue;
+ }
+}
